This original Neil Peart painting, created before his passing, was designed to celebrate the legendary drummer and his iconic drum kit. The painting captures the breathtaking view from above his kit, immortalizing the intricate details of his setup. Painted in pop art and semi-abstract styles, it invites a second look to appreciate the complexity, circles, lines, and shapes that form Peart’s drum kit, as well as a tribute to his distinctive profile at the top of his head.
Using a monochromatic acrylic grey palette, the high hats are highlighted in yellow to evoke a golden impression, giving the piece a unique depth and focus. Initially created to celebrate Peart’s unparalleled drumming skills, the painting has grown into much more. Following his death, it has become a poignant pop art tribute to the man who redefined rock drumming, capturing the essence of his passion as he smashed his drums. This artwork serves as a remembrance of Neil Peart’s genius, honoring his legacy.
Painted on 12oz cotton box canvas and ready to hang. Painted with a wrap around effect so there are no unsightly nails or staples,
or visible canvas.
Acrylic paintings are painted in a mixture of Golden, Liquitex and Winsor and Newton professional acrylic paints. Gouache paintings are painted in Liquitex. Spray painted paintings use
MTN 94, Montana Gold and Molotow.
All painting are finished with a non yellowing spray matt varnish.
